StormTRACK Weather: Colder air moves in just in time for Santa’s arrival

Christmas Eve will be much colder with temperatures running about 10 to 15 degrees cooler than yesterday. A second push of cold air will drop high temperatures into the low 50s and upper 40s this afternoon. There won't be any snow tomorrow just partly cloudy skies with highs in the 50s.
